88 dogs rescued....
On Wednesday, January 28th, 2012, Animal Rescue of Carroll came together with other shelters and rescues across Iowa to help rescue and remove 88 dogs living in deplorable conditions in a rural Sac County, Iowa property. Animal Rescue of Carroll took in 6 of these dogs, 1 male and 5 females, two of which are pregnant and due any day.
